When I download a product help file from the website, none of the pages are displayed. I get a page that says "The page cannot be displayed". How can I solve this?
The problem is caused by Windows security features
To solve it right click the downloaded .chm file in Windows Explorer and unblock it. The Unblock command is either in the context menu or in the Properties dialog

Can running ApexSQL product be scheduled?
Yes, most of our products have CLI and execution of CLI statements can be scheduled using SQL Server Jobs or Windows Task Scheduler
Can I use ApexSQL product projects on other machines?
Yes, just make sure that the save password option is not checked when saving the project
I'm using SQL authentication to connect to SQL Server. How secure is my password when handled by ApexSQL products?
ApexSQL products will store SQL Server password only if the password saving option is selected when saving a project. It will be saved in an encrypted format. Nobody will be able to use these credentials on any other machine. The password encryption is machine-dependent, so even if the complete project file is transferred to another machine, products on the new machine will be unable to read the stored credentials
What are the .log files in %AppDataLocal%\ApexSQL folder created by ApexSQL products?
These are ApexSQL product log files. They help us debug problems encountered with ApexSQL products. Our Support engineers might ask you to send them. You can do that without worries that personal data or SQL Server credentials are stored in them. If you want to check log files yourself, open them in any text editor
Is a database snapshot created by ApexSQL tools the same as the snapshot created by MS SQL Server database snapshot feature?
No. ApexSQL snapshots have .axsnp file extension and can be used only with our products
